EDITORS COMMENTS
This print showcases the patent drawing for a groundbreaking sanitary innovation by Thomas Crapper, known as the Water Waste Preventer. Dating back to the 1880s, this invention revolutionized toilet and plumbing systems, forever changing sanitation practices. The intricate diagram depicted in this print unveils Crapper's brilliant idea and design for a water closet that efficiently prevented unnecessary water waste. This visionary concept aimed to optimize hygiene while conserving precious resources, making it an invaluable contribution to society. Thomas Crapper's name has become synonymous with toilets due to his numerous inventions and advancements in plumbing technology.
